Chetan Mehrotra commented on OAK-28: ------------------------------------ Another change required in Indexer. The flushBuffer method is currently hiding the exception thrown {code} } catch (MicroKernelException e) { if (!mk.nodeExists(indexRootNode, revision)) { // the index node itself was removed, which is // unexpected but possible // this will cause all indexes to be removed, so // it can be ignored here + }else{ + throw e; } } {code} With a bit older codebase with IndexWrapper in use I saw some exceptions on restart like {noformat} org.apache.jackrabbit.mk.api.MicroKernelException: org.h2.jdbc.JdbcSQLException: Unique index or primary key violation: "PRIMARY_KEY_2 ON PUBLIC.REVS(ID)"; SQL statement: insert into REVS (ID, DATA, TIME) select ?, ?, ?
